8.3 Configuration 3

Daytime the lamps in a group are always off
If a motion detect is detected on camera 1 the lamps should go into deterrent mode

for 60 seconds, SOS fast



Camera 1 raises a hardware event when motion is detected, this event is called
Cam1MotionDetect.

Create the following manual events:

Group1DarkTrigger
Group1DeterTrigger
Group1LightTrigger


Create an alarm called Group1PhotocellDay, select the triggering event as Vario IP Lamp
and Photocell Day. Click the select button and associate Lamp 1 and Lamp 2 with this
alarm. Click the select button at the bottom of the screen next to Events triggered by alarm
and select the Group1LightTrigger.

Create a second alarm called Group1PhotocellNight, select the triggering event as Vario IP
Lamp and Photocell Night. Click the select button and associate Lamp 1 and Lamp 2 with
this alarm. Click the select button at the bottom of the screen next to Events triggered by
alarm and select the Group1DarkTrigger.

Create a third alarm called Group1CameraMotDet, select the triggering event as System
Events and External Event. Click the select button and associate Camera1MotionDetect
hardware event with this alarm. Change the activation period to Event based and select the
start event as Group1DarkTrigger and the off event as Group1LightTrigger. Click the select
button at the bottom of the screen next to Events triggered by alarm and select the
Group1DeterTrigger.


Select Group 1 in the Raytec Vario IP node set the following information on the page.

Group Deter Trigger

Event: Group1DeterTrigger
Deterrent ends after: 60 seconds
And reverts back to previous power level
Mode: SOS
Speed: Fast



We ensure the lamp only goes into deterrent mode during the night by only allowing the
deterrent trigger event to be raised during the period after the photocell has indicated it is
dark but before the photocell has indicated it is light.
